Code For Bharat Season 2 Hackathon: Stages and Timelines
Profile Shortlisting Round
Before the online pitch round, participants will first be shortlisted based on their LinkedIn and GitHub profiles submitted during registration. This helps us find teams who have worked on projects, contributed to tech communities, or shown interest in building things.
Online Round
The online round serves as the qualifier stage, where shortlisted teams will present their projects or prototypes live to a panel of mentors via Google Meet. Each team will have 5 minutes to pitch their idea, followed by a 2-minute Q&A session. Teams will be evaluated and scored based on innovation, feasibility, and clarity of presentation. The top 25 teams with the highest scores will advance to the offline Grand Finale.
Offline Grand Finale
The Offline Grand Finale of Code For Bharat Season 2 is set for 2nd August 2025 at Microsoft Office, Sovereign Capital, Noida. The top 25 teams will compete in an 8-hour hackathon, presenting impactful solutions to expert judges. Themes:
Participants are encouraged to innovate and build impactful solutions around:
- Generative AI & LLMs
- Blockchain Technology & Web3
- Sustainable Tech & Climate Innovation
- EdTech Solutions & Learning Transformation
- Open Innovation

Rules:
- Open-source libraries are allowed
- No plagiarism or reuse of previously built projects
- Participants must comply with all event rules and instructions
- Decisions by the judging panel are final and binding
